NettetShare your views about how you think we can improve our Local Offer. Ofsted and the Care Quality Commission (CQC) are visiting Lincolnshire to understand more about alternative provision. As part of the visits, inspectors want to know more about how needs are being met for children and young people who go to alternative provision.
